abstract:
The experimentally measured single helical states in the low aspect ratio (R/a=2) RELAX
device have been compared with the predictions of a cylindrical relaxation theory and a
substantial deviation in terms of some macroscopic characteristics has been found, in particular
for cases corresponding to a large reversal of the edge toroidal field.
In this paper we consider the effect of the toroidal geometry by employing the VMEC and the
RelaxFit equilibrium codes. We show that the inclusion of toroidicity produces significant
corrections to the cylindrical states, especially for the deep reversed cases.
